Claims (1)

【実用新案登録請求の範囲】[Scope of utility model registration request] 厚い側壁で囲まれたパツケージ基体の中央凹所
に半導体素子が固着された下部および上部パツケ
ージ基体を有し、かつ、前記下部および上部パツ
ケージ基体の側壁上面が突き合うようにして重ね
合わされ、前記それぞれの半導体素子の電極パツ
ドにつながる外部リードが共に前記下部パツケー
ジ基体の底面または側面から外部に引き出されて
いることを特徴とする半導体装置。
The lower and upper package bases have lower and upper package bases in which a semiconductor element is fixed to a central recess of the package base surrounded by thick side walls, and the lower and upper package bases are stacked so that the upper surfaces of the side walls abut against each other, and A semiconductor device characterized in that external leads connected to electrode pads of the semiconductor element are both led out from the bottom or side surface of the lower package base.
